On Fri, Jan 31, 2014 at 4:12 PM,  <scottwd80 at gmail.com> wrote:
> **If I leave my house at 6:52 am and run 1 mile at an easy pace (8:15 per mile), then 3 miles at tempo (7:12 per mile) and 1 mile at easy pace again, what time do I get home for breakfast?**
>
>
>
>      seconds = 1
>      hours = seconds / (60*60)
>      seconds = seconds - hours*60*60
>      minutes = seconds / 60
>      seconds = seconds - minutes *60
>
>      time_left_house = 6 * hours + 52 * minutes
>
>      miles_run_easy_pace = 2 * (8 * minutes + 15 * seconds)
>
>      miles_run_fast_pace = 3 * (7 * minutes + 12 * seconds)
>
>
>      total_time_run = miles_run_easy_pace + miles_run_fast_pace + time_left_house

Thanks for being up-front about it being homework. I'll give you one
broad hint, and see if you can figure it out from there.

Your beginning work is not actually achieving anything useful. To make
your next steps work, what you actually want is two very simple
assignments that will mean that "6 * hours" comes out as the number of
seconds in six hours. Then, when you've added all the different pieces
together, you'll have a final time that's measured in seconds - and
since that final time includes the time_left_house, it's actually
going to be the number of seconds since midnight. This is actually an
excellent way to represent time (number of seconds since some
"beginning point" aka epoch). There's then just one last step: Convert
it into hours, minutes, and seconds, for display. You have most of the
code for doing that.

So, work on this in two parts. In the first part, make your program
calculate how many seconds after midnight you'll get home. (The
correct answer there is 27006, according to my calculations. Of
course, you need to have a program that produces the correct answer,
not just the answer.) Then work out how to make that display as
hh:mm:ss.

I think you can probably get it from there - you're already a lot of
the way toward it. But if not, you know where to find us :)
